I very much doubt that is the problem, if you were loosing cylinder pressure there there would be a obvious noise of escaping gas and the head gasket would also have to be blown at that point. I suspect a bad valve, bent pushrod or bad lifter(probably a bad valve).... Just my thoughts....Tedd
I also cannot imagine the stripped intake manifold bolt hole being the source of your problem. The lack of a seal at that point should indeed cause performance problems, but not a loss of compression.
The two bolt marked 7 and 8 are clamping the intake at the cross over on the cooling system so if they were leaking then antifreeze would either be leaking outward or burning when running, can you smell burning antifreeze from the exhaust? Checking for a cooling leak won't work as the leak is ahead of the compression chamber, otherwise I would pull the galley cover and check all of the lifters, a small amount of dirt can clog one enough to not open intake valve enough but move it enough to not make a tappet noise ( had one go bad while driving to a cruise, ended up replacing them all)

Agree with several previous posters, an intake leak is not the current reason for low compression; although, it could lead to a burned valve if it was causing a lean condition due to a vacuum leak. Do a leak down test to see where air escapes from, the carburetor (leaking intake valve), exhaust pipe (leaking exhaust valve) and/or out of the crankcase through a breather or oil fill hole (ring and/or piston problem).
If it was mine I would run it for a while to see if something is sticking as it has only been driven 16K miles in 24 years. The problem could be a weak valve spring if the motor sat for an extended period without being rotated. The springs that are compressed during the long term storage can become weak and will not close the valve tight enough to make a good seal. Replacing a valve spring does not require removing the cylinder head.
The only potential problem I see is if it is a ring problem, there is a chance that running it might score a cylinder wall.

From what you have described, I would not think the intake manifold is your problem. If it were me, I would do a leak down test first. Most compression gauges have a hose that utilizes a standard air line quick disconnect. Remove the Schrader valve from the end that screws into the head. You can use a valve core remover tool. Don't loose the valve. It is different than the valve core used for tires, but looks similar. Remove the coil wire. Screw the hose in. Stick your finger over the end and bring the piston up to TDC with a friend bumping the ignition. You can unscrew the hose and put the eraser end of a pencil into the spark plug hole. Now turn the engine very slowly back and forth from the crank balancer bolt with a breaker bar. The reason it needs to be exactly at TDC is, when you put compressed air into the cylinder it will try to push the piston down, unless you have a serious leak. A leak down tester is basically just a hose with two gauges hooked up and an air pressure regulator. One shows how much air is going in and the other shows rate of leakage. You should hook up an air pressure regulator at your compressor. Set it for 50-75 PSI. Now hook up the air and see if you have a leak. Listen at the carb (intake valve), listen at the tail pipe (exhaust valve), and listen at the oil fill tube (rings or piston problem). It's really not necessary to know how much leakage you have unless you're trying to do a comparison between cylinders. The important thing is to pinpoint the leak source. I believe you have a burnt valve. You said you can see them moving up and down so that pretty much rules out a bent valve. Usually if the rings are not sealing well you would not drop that much compression and it would come up by oiling the cylinder for your compression test. Very often when there is a burnt valve you may have back firing. The other reason I would not try running it too long is, you could create more problems, and damage other internal components if you have a bad valve or rings. First of all, 2 PSI is not enough. I believe you should have 5-6 PSI. Here's what I would do. Have a catch pan ready, and disconnect the feed line to the fuel pump. If fuel drains out, try to remove the gas cap. If it continues to drain, cap the end with a hose and a bolt, or a correct size rubber vacuum cap. Now install another fuel line going into a five gallon gas can. Crank it over and check your fuel pressure. If your fuel pressure is good now, your problem is in the fuel line, strainer or gas tank. If you don't have good pressure, you should replace the pump. If you do have good pressure, there's a couple things you could try. Remove the cap from the line and blow compressed air back toward the tank. Don't use full blasted air pressure. Try to listen and feel for a restriction while blowing back to the fuel tank. You should hear bubbling in the tank. If you do feel a restriction, there's a good chance the strainer is clogged in the tank. I'm betting you have a fuel pump issue. If the strainer is clogged you may want to have the tank cleaned or boiled out. Usually radiator shops can help with that. Some of these older cars didn't even have strainers. You could also try blowing compressed air with a rag at the filler neck to seal it up. You should get a nice stream of fuel out of the line into the catch pan. The other thing you should do is inspect the fuel line very carefully from front to back. If you see any signs of dampness, you probably have a rusted pin hole. You could disconnect the fuel line at the tank, plug it, and use a hand held vacuum pump at the other end. Pump it up and see if it holds vacuum.
